
Miami FC Falls to FC Tulsa at FIU Stadium
August 11, 2022 - United Soccer League Championship (USL)
Miami FC News Release
Miami, Fla. - The Miami Football Club lost to FC Tulsa 2-1 on Wednesday night. The defeat snapped Miami's four-game undefeated streak.
The Orange and Blue remain in seventh place in the Eastern Conference. However, Tulsa is now six points away from MFC.
Starting XI vs. FC Tulsa
Head coach Anthony Pulis deployed the same exact starting lineup used against New Mexico United over the weekend.
Miami FC 1-2 FC Tulsa: Match Breakdown
The game was uneventful until captain Paco Craig pulled Miami FC ahead in the 25th minute. Winger Joaquín Rivas sent an out-swinging cross from a free-kick to the second post. There, Craig met the ball with his head and powered it through goalkeeper Austin Wormell and into the goal.
Unfortunately for Miami, the lead was short-lived. Former MFC forward Darío Suárez equalized less than two minutes after going down on the scoreboard. And by the 40th minute, Tulsa overtook Miami thanks to a goal from winger Noah Powder.
FC Tulsa sat back in the second half, securing its first three points on the road.
Up Next for Miami FC
Miami FC will hit the road once again, this time to Atlanta, Ga. The side will face Atlanta United II on Saturday at 7:30 p.m. ET.
The Orange and Blue return to Miami on Aug. 27. They will face current Eastern Conference leaders Louisville City at FIU Stadium.
